Understanding Spider Behavior
Understanding spider behavior is key to effective and long-lasting spider removal. Different species have different habits and habitats. For example, some spiders prefer dark, damp places, while others build elaborate webs in open areas. Knowing these preferences allows us to target our treatments more effectively.
The Importance of Identifying Spider Species
Proper identification of spider species is crucial because it dictates the appropriate treatment methods. Some spiders, like the black widow or brown recluse, are venomous and require extra caution. Our technicians are trained to identify these species and take the necessary precautions to ensure your safety.
Furthermore, some spiders are indicators of other pest problems. For instance, a large number of spiders may indicate the presence of other insects, such as flies or beetles, which serve as their food source. Addressing the underlying pest issue can help to reduce the spider population as well.
Common Problems & Signs You Need Spider Removal
Constant Sightings of Spiders Indoors
If you're frequently seeing spiders inside your home, it’s a clear sign that you may have an infestation. While a stray spider here and there isn't cause for alarm, consistent sightings suggest that spiders are finding a way inside and establishing themselves. It indicates potential entry points and hospitable conditions within your home that are attracting these pests.
Multiple Webs Appearing Regularly
Spider webs are a telltale sign of their presence, and if you notice webs reappearing shortly after you clean them, it means spiders are actively building and hunting in your space. This isn't just unsightly; it also means there's a food source present, such as other insects, which is sustaining the spider population. The more webs you see, the more entrenched the spider problem is becoming.
Presence of Egg Sacs
Finding egg sacs is a significant indicator of a growing spider population on your property. Spiders lay hundreds of eggs in these sacs, which means a single sac can lead to a large influx of new spiders if not dealt with promptly. Discovering egg sacs means the spiders aren't just passing through; they're actively reproducing and setting up a permanent residence.
Bites or Signs of Spider Activity
Although rare, spider bites can occur, especially if venomous species are present. While many bites may be attributed to other insects, unexplained bites or skin irritations could be a sign of spider activity. In addition, noticing shed skins or spider droppings in certain areas can also indicate a spider infestation. These signs point to a more serious issue that requires professional intervention.
Increased Spider Activity During Certain Seasons
Spider activity often increases during specific seasons, such as fall, as they seek shelter from the cooling weather and look for mates. If you notice a surge in spider sightings during these times, it's crucial to take proactive measures to prevent them from establishing a strong presence in your home. Seasonal increases can quickly escalate into year-round problems if left unchecked.

Unexplained Insect Infestations
If you're dealing with other insect infestations, it could also attract spiders. Spiders are predators, and they will be drawn to areas with an abundance of prey. Addressing the underlying insect problem can indirectly reduce the spider population. In these cases, a comprehensive pest control approach is necessary to tackle both issues effectively.
Spider Prevention Tips: Maintaining a Spider-Free Home
While professional treatments are essential for an ongoing Spider Removal in Hammond, IN, there are several steps you can take to deter spiders and maintain a spider-free home. Sealing cracks and crevices in your foundation and around windows and doors can prevent spiders from entering your home. Using caulk or weather stripping to seal these gaps can create a barrier that spiders can't penetrate. By minimizing potential entry points, you'll make it more difficult for spiders to find their way inside.
Reducing clutter in and around your home deprives spiders of hiding spots. Piles of wood, leaves, or debris provide spiders with shelter and make it easier for them to thrive. Regularly clearing these areas can reduce the attractiveness of your property to spiders. Inside your home, decluttering closets, attics, and basements can also eliminate hiding places and make it easier to spot any signs of spider activity.
Maintaining a clean and well-ventilated home can deter spiders. Spiders are attracted to damp and humid environments, so proper ventilation can make your home less appealing. Regularly cleaning your home can remove food sources that attract spiders, such as crumbs and other insects. Vacuuming, sweeping, and dusting can eliminate spider webs, egg sacs, and other signs of spider activity.
Addressing the Root Cause: A Holistic Approach to Spider Control
Effective spider control goes beyond simply eliminating the spiders you see. It involves addressing the root cause of the infestation and implementing a holistic approach to prevent future problems. One of the key aspects of a integrated pest management strategy is identifying and eliminating the sources of food that attract spiders to your home. These food sources typically consist of other small insects living in your home such as silverfish, cockroaches or mosquitoes
Moisture can also attract spiders. Address any leaks or sources of excessive humidity to make your home less appealing. Consider using a dehumidifier in damp areas, such as basements and crawl spaces. Proper ventilation can also help to reduce moisture levels and deter spiders.
A holistic approach to spider control also involves considering the ecological impact of your pest control measures. Avoid using broad-spectrum insecticides that can harm beneficial insects and disrupt the ecosystem. Instead, opt for targeted treatments that focus specifically on spiders. This approach minimizes the risk to non-target species and helps to maintain a healthy balance in your environment.
